Commercial Slab Installation in Fort Worth, TX
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for a variety of property projects, including parking lots, driveways, building foundations, and outdoor workspaces. This process ensures a stable, level surface that supports heavy loads and withstands daily use. Property owners typically seek this service when constructing new commercial facilities or upgrading existing outdoor areas, aiming for a durable and long-lasting result. Before requesting a slab installation, it’s important to understand the scope of the project, site conditions, and any necessary permits or planning considerations to ensure the work aligns with local building codes and property needs.
Property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the slab, the size and shape of the area, and the soil conditions at the site. Proper preparation, including site excavation and compaction, is crucial for a successful installation. Additionally, understanding the reinforcement options and finishing details can impact the durability and appearance of the finished slab. Clear communication about project expectations and site specifics can help ensure the installation process meets the property’s requirements and provides a solid foundation for years to come.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installation is commonly used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and industrial flooring in property developments and business facilities.
What materials are typically used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the standard material for commercial slabs due to its durability and strength, often reinforced with steel for added support.
How is the site prepared before slab installation? Site preparation includes clearing debris, leveling the ground, and setting proper drainage to ensure a stable foundation for the slab.
What factors influence the design of a commercial slab? Factors include the intended use, load requirements, soil conditions, and local building codes to ensure safety and longevity.
